Name

CG_Intersects — 二つのジオメトリがインタセクトしている (少なくとも一つの共有点がある)かどうかテストします。

Synopsis

boolean CG_Intersects( geometry geomA , geometry geomB );

説明

二つのジオメトリがインタセクトする場合にTRUEを返します。任意の共有点を持つ場合を指します。

SFCGALモジュールによって実行されます

[Note]

ご注意: これは論理値を返して整数を返さないのが「許される」版です。

Availability: 3.5.0

このメソッドにはSFCGALバックエンドが必要です。

この関数は三角形と不規則三角網 (TIN)に対応しています。

ジオメトリの例

SELECT CG_Intersects('POINT(0 0)'::geometry, 'LINESTRING ( 2 0, 0 2 )'::geometry);
    cg_intersects
    ---------------
    f
    (1 row)
    SELECT CG_Intersects('POINT(0 0)'::geometry, 'LINESTRING ( 0 0, 0 2 )'::geometry);
    cg_intersects
    ---------------
    t
    (1 row)